List by list
England and Wales · Boys26 shared years, 1996–2024
Emmett held the stronger position in 2 of those years, Hunter in 24.
Highest recorded here: Emmett #568 in 2020, Hunter #44 in 2018.
The order changed in 2000: Hunter moved ahead. In 1999 they stood at #1850 and #2425; by 2000 that had become #3036 and #1425.
Most recent shared year, 2024: Emmett #622, Hunter #78.
Northern Ireland · Boys15 shared years, 2008–2024
Emmett held the stronger position in 3 of those years, Hunter in 12.
Highest recorded here: Emmett #174 in 2012, Hunter #70 in 2019.
The order changed in 2013: Hunter moved ahead. In 2012 they stood at #174 and #273; by 2013 that had become #244 and #208.
Most recent shared year, 2024: Emmett #339, Hunter #93.
Republic of Ireland · Boys14 shared years, 2012–2025
Emmett held the stronger position in 1 of those years, Hunter in 13.
Highest recorded here: Emmett #317 in 2013, Hunter #91 in 2021.
The order between them never changed and held in this list.
Most recent shared year, 2025: Emmett #432, Hunter #159.
